Frequently Asked Questions about Miami Beach
How much are Studio apartments in Miami Beach?
There are currently 1,215 Studio Apartments in Miami Beach with rent ranges from $1,200 to $10,512 with an average price of $2,821.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Miami Beach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Miami Beach ranges from $1,200 to $21,816 with an average monthly rent of $3,274.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Miami Beach c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Miami Beach range from $1,850 to $25,417.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,461.
How expensive are Miami Beach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 256 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Miami Beach on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,300 to $31,086 - averaging $6,897 for the location.
